Jeimmy's usage pattern, beyond the headline number

Splitting Jeimmy's full recorded timeline at 2015, 53% of its total births fall in the more recent half of the record versus 47% in the earlier half -- a fairly even split across the full record. Its quietest year on record was 2015, with just 5 recorded births -- worth weighing against the 2012 peak of 7 to see the full range of the name's swing in popularity.
